Chapter 19. Exporting and Importing Data

ADSM provides an export-import facility that allows you to copy all or part of a server to removable media (export) so that data can be transferred to another server (import).
Task Required Privilege Class
Perform export and import operations System
Display information about export and import operations Any administrator

In this chapter, most examples illustrate how to perform tasks by using the ADSM command line interface. For information about the ADSM commands, see ADSM Administrator's Reference, or issue the HELP command from the command line of an ADSM administrative client.

All of the ADSM commands can be performed from the administrative client web interface. A Version 3 administrative client GUI is also available for the Windows NT and Windows 95 operating systems. For more information about using the administrative interfaces, see ADSM Quick Start. You can find detailed help for using the graphical user interfaces in the online help facilities.
